Some of the best TV screens are designed to bring your favorite blockbusters to life, but watching fast-paced games is a different story.

If you’re looking for the best TVs for sports, now is one of the smartest times of the year to shop as new models tends to come out each spring, meaning there’s a fresh selection of inventory from top brands. While watching sports at home is a different experience than being at the game, modern state-of-the-art TVs offer features such as wide-screen viewing, Dolby Vision and immersive Dolby Atmos that make you feel as if you’re in the middle of the game.

“Great picture is equally as important as great sound,” John Couling, senior vice president of entertainment at Dolby, tells The Hollywood Reporter, “which is why [in addition HDR or Dolby Vision] I’d recommend looking for a TV with Dolby Atmos if you care about sports. It plays a critical role in making you feel as if you are in the stadium by bringing the electricity of the crowd alive.”
